The Space Challenge: Why Living Off Earth Is So Hard

To set the stage, astronauts and engineers explain that microgravity, radiation exposure, limited supplies, and the psychological toll make sustained life in space a colossal hurdle. Even with the most advanced technology, replicating Earth’s nurturing environment is nearly impossible. Every element must be meticulously managed—from oxygen levels to waste recycling.
